Kaiser Permanente health fair draws record crowd

Denver, CO – Nearly 3,000 Coloradans without health insurance received free care at the 8th annual Neighbors in Health health fair given by Kaiser Permanente on Sunday, August 8, 2004. That is the most number of participants ever to register for the one-day health fair.

"More than 700,000 Coloradans have no health insurance," says Juan Miranda, Medical Director of Kaiser Permanente's Clinica de Familia. "Kaiser Permanente is committed to giving back to our community and addressing this very serious problem in our state. We also think it's important to provide health care in a bilingual fashion for our growing Hispanic community."

People began lining up hours before the doors opened just for a chance to take advantage of a range of services, including vision screening, dental care, immunizations, women's and children's exams, diabetes and cholesterol screenings, and more. The fair was held at Kaiser Permanente's Skyline Medical Offices in Denver.

The event was sponsored by Kaiser Permanente, in partnership with Colorado Children's Automobile Safety Association, Colorado Department of Public Health and Environment, Colorado Pathology Consultants, Exempla Saint Joseph Hospital, Visiting Nurse Association, Univision Channel 50, Telefutura Channel 36, Radio Tri-Color 1090 AM, and Radio Romantica 92.1 FM.
